Two major sources of oil pollution in the ocean are oil spills and oil runoff from land-based sources. Oil spills occur when oil is released into the ocean from accidents or leaks during transportation, drilling, or storage. Oil runoff refers to the pollution caused by oil and petroleum products that are washed off from land surfaces into rivers and eventually reach the ocean through runoff.

Most of the oil that pollutes the ocean is caused by human activities such as oil spills from tankers and offshore drilling, as well as runoff from land-based sources like industrial facilities and urban areas. Accidents, leaks, and improper disposal of oil products contribute significantly to oil pollution in marine environments.

Ships can pollute the ocean through oil spills, waste discharge, and emissions of pollutants like sulfur dioxide and nitrogen oxides. Accidental spills from oil tankers or leaks from ship engines can harm marine ecosystems and wildlife. Additionally, dumping untreated sewage and garbage can introduce harmful bacteria and toxins into the ocean.
